Fitness Training for Your Mount Kenya Climb

Fitness Training for Your Mount Kenya Climb

As someone with great experience in guiding mountain climbs, I can tell you that Mount Kenya’s terrain is as varied as it is breathtaking. To climb Mount Kenya, you need to be quite fit because the journey takes you through different environments, starting with the lush forests at the base. These lower altitudes are rich with wildlife and dense vegetation, making the initial ascent both beautiful and challenging. Here is a guide to fitness training for your Mount Kenya climb.

As you gain altitude, the landscape transitions into moorlands, where you’ll encounter unique flora like giant lobelias amidst rocky outcrops. The final push to the summit is the most demanding, with scree slopes, glaciers, and sharp ridges that require careful navigation and a strong physical foundation.

The physical demands of climbing Mount Kenya are significant. Each day involves long hours of trekking, often up steep and uneven paths. As you ascend, the air becomes thinner, reducing oxygen levels and making every step more strenuous.

1.     Cardiovascular Training

Cardiovascular training is essential for your preparation to climb Mount Kenya. It focuses on building your heart and lung capacity, which will directly impact your performance, especially at high altitudes.

  1. Importance of Cardiovascular Endurance

When climbing at high altitudes, you’ll face challenges due to lower oxygen levels. This makes cardiovascular endurance crucial, as it helps your body utilize oxygen more efficiently. During long trekking days, you’ll rely heavily on your endurance and stamina to maintain energy and keep moving, even when the terrain becomes tough. Building your cardiovascular fitness will ensure you’re ready to handle these demanding conditions.

  1. Suggested Exercises

To improve your cardiovascular fitness, consider incorporating various exercises into your training regimen. Running is an excellent choice, focusing on both long-distance runs to build endurance and interval training to boost speed. Cycling, whether outdoors or on a stationary bike, is another effective way to strengthen your heart and legs. Stair climbing and hill sprints will mimic the steep ascents you’ll encounter on the mountain. Hiking with a weighted backpack simulates the conditions you’ll experience during the climb, helping you build both strength and endurance.

  1. Training Schedule

You should aim to schedule your cardiovascular training 3-5 times a week, dedicating 30-60 minutes to each session. Consistent training will help build your endurance over time, allowing your body to adapt to the demands of the climb. By sticking to this routine, you’ll feel more confident and prepared for the challenges that lie ahead as you take on Mount Kenya.

2.     Strength Training

Strength training is crucial for preparing your body to handle the physical challenges of climbing Mount Kenya. It focuses on building the muscular strength needed to carry your gear, navigate difficult terrain, and maintain stamina throughout the climb.

A. Importance of Muscular Strength

Muscular strength is essential for carrying gear and supplies, which can be heavy and require endurance over long periods. Additionally, navigating rough terrain, including rock scrambles and steep inclines, demands strong legs, core, and upper body muscles. Building strength in these areas will make the climb safer and more manageable.

B. Key Areas to Focus On

To prepare effectively, focus on strengthening specific muscle groups. For your legs, exercises like squats, lunges, deadlifts, and step-ups are ideal. These exercises build the power needed for steep climbs. For your core, planks, mountain climbers, and Russian twists help stabilize your body during movement. For your upper body, push-ups, pull-ups, and shoulder presses are important for carrying gear and pulling yourself up over rocks.

C. Training Schedule

Aim to incorporate strength training into your routine 2-3 times a week. Perform 3 sets of 8-12 repetitions for each exercise to build strength gradually. This schedule allows for muscle recovery while steadily improving your overall strength.

3.     Flexibility and Mobility

Flexibility and mobility are key components of your training that help prevent injury and improve movement efficiency. Being flexible ensures that your muscles and joints can move through their full range of motion without strain.

A. Importance of Flexibility

Flexibility is important for preventing muscle strain and injury, particularly during the long, demanding days of climbing. It also improves your movement efficiency, making it easier to navigate uneven terrain and maintain balance.

B. Suggested Stretching Routine

Incorporate both dynamic and static stretches into your routine. Dynamic stretches, such as leg swings and arm circles, are best before workouts to warm up your muscles. After workouts, static stretches like hamstring, quad, and calf stretches help with muscle recovery. Yoga poses such as downward dog, warrior poses, and pigeon pose are also excellent for improving flexibility and mobility, particularly for climbers.

C. Training Schedule

You should aim to stretch daily, dedicating 10-15 minutes per session. Consistent stretching helps maintain flexibility and prepares your body for the physical demands of climbing, reducing the risk of injury and improving overall performance.

4.     Altitude Training and Acclimatization

Altitude training and acclimatization are essential for preparing your body to handle the lower oxygen levels at higher elevations on Mount Kenya. Proper preparation can significantly reduce the risks associated with altitude sickness.

A. Understanding Altitude Sickness

Altitude sickness occurs when your body struggles to adapt to the reduced oxygen levels at high altitudes. Symptoms include headaches, nausea, dizziness, and shortness of breath. Prevention involves ascending slowly, staying hydrated, and allowing your body time to adjust to the altitude.

B. Simulating Altitude Conditions

To prepare for high-altitude conditions, consider training in environments with similar altitudes if possible. If that’s not feasible, using hypoxic masks or altitude simulation chambers can help your body get used to lower oxygen levels, simulating the conditions you’ll experience on the mountain.

C. Gradual Acclimatization During the Climb

During the climb, gradual acclimatization is key. The “climb high, sleep low” strategy involves ascending to higher altitudes during the day but returning to a lower elevation to sleep, allowing your body to adjust. Incorporating acclimatization hikes into your ascent schedule also helps your body gradually adapt to the changing altitude, reducing the risk of altitude sickness.

5.     Nutrition and Hydration

Proper nutrition and hydration are critical for maintaining energy levels and supporting recovery during your Mount Kenya climb. A well-planned diet and hydration strategy will help your body perform at its best throughout the ascent.

·        Suggested Diet

A balanced diet with adequate carbohydrates, proteins, and healthy fats is essential for sustained energy. Carbohydrates provide quick energy, proteins support muscle repair, and healthy fats offer long-lasting fuel. High-energy foods like nuts, seeds, and dried fruits are particularly useful on the trail, as they are easy to carry and provide a concentrated source of nutrients.

·         Hydration Strategies

Staying hydrated is crucial at high altitudes, where dehydration can occur more quickly. Regular water intake is necessary to maintain fluid levels and prevent dehydration. Additionally, balancing electrolytes is important, as you lose salts through sweat. Consider using electrolyte tablets or drinks to maintain the right balance and support your overall hydration.
